Estimated 1.5–2 billion wooden pallets circulate in the U.S. supply chain each year.

This large stock of available material means a steady, low-cost supply of salvageable pallets for DIY builders and small makers sourcing raw boards.

Typical build time for a basic upcycled pallet coffee table is 6–12 hours; complex builds (epoxy, custom inlays) take 12–30 hours.

Are pallet coffee tables safe to use inside my home? +

Yes—pallet coffee tables can be safe if you select heat-treated (HT) pallets and avoid those stamped with MB (methyl bromide) or unknown markings. Always inspect for chemical stains, remove nails, sand thoroughly, and seal the wood with a tested finish (polyurethane, oil, or epoxy) to lock in contaminants and prevent splinters.

How do I identify which pallets are safe for furniture projects? +

Look for the ISPM 15 stamp with 'HT' (heat treated) and avoid pallets marked 'MB' (methyl bromide) or with heavy chemical/industrial product logos. Also check for obvious stains, odors, or damage; clean and sand suspect pallets and, when in doubt, use internal boards rather than deck boards for visible surfaces.

What are ideal dimensions for an upcycled pallet coffee table? +

Common coffee table dimensions are 40–48 inches long, 18–20 inches deep, and 16–18 inches high, but pallet-based tables often use a 36–42 inch length if built from two pallet decks. Design to match your sofa height (table should be equal to or slightly lower than the seat height) and plan the footprint based on your living room traffic flow.

How much does it cost to build a pallet coffee table? +

Material costs for upcycled pallet coffee tables are typically $10–$60 if you source free or low-cost pallets and reuse hardware, plus $20–$100 for paint/finish and new fasteners or casters. Expect tool amortization (sander, saw, drill) to add value if you don't already own them, and specialized finishes (epoxy, powder coat) will raise costs.

What tools and hardware are essential for a clean, durable build? +

At minimum: pry bar or multi-tool for deconstruction, circular saw or miter saw, orbital sander, drill/driver, pocket-hole jig or clamps, wood glue, screws, and protective gear. Add casters, metal hairpin legs, or adjustable feet for mobility/stability and a router or plane for smoothing joinery if you want a professional finish.

How do I disassemble pallets without splitting the boards? +

Use a demolition/reciprocal saw or oscillating multi-tool to cut nails and a pry bar with a scrap block to leverage boards gently; heat-treated pallets can be easier to split with a saw. For best results, score along the nail line first, remove nails with a nail puller to preserve board integrity, and consider reusable pallet busters or saws designed for cutting between boards.

What finish is best for a durable upcycled pallet coffee table? +

For indoor tables a penetrating oil (tung/linseed) followed by satin polyurethane or conversion varnish balances warmth and durability; for high-gloss or modern looks use epoxy topcoat. For outdoor use use marine-grade spar varnish or exterior epoxy and raise the table on stainless hardware and weatherproof feet.

How long does a typical pallet coffee table build take? +

An experienced DIYer can complete a simple pallet coffee table in a single weekend (6–12 hours) including deconstruction, assembly, and a single finish coat; more elaborate joinery, multi-coat finishes, or integrated storage add 2–5 days due to drying times. Plan additive time for paint or epoxy cures and unexpected repairs to reclaimed boards.

Can I sell upcycled pallet coffee tables and what price can I expect? +

Yes—handmade pallet coffee tables sell online and at markets; typical retail prices for well-finished pieces range $120–$450 depending on style, finish, and local market. Maximize price by offering professional photos, accurate shipping options or local pickup, and by emphasizing safety (HT-stamped pallets), provenance, and custom sizing.

How do I make a pallet coffee table easier to ship or ship safely? +

Design for partial disassembly (detachable legs or a removable top) and use protective packaging for corners and brittle reclaimed wood, or offer local pickup/delivery for heavier pieces. For shipping, use crating with pallets or rigid foam blocks, insure the shipment, and account shipping costs in your price or listing.
